

如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
基于BS模式高校机房管理支撑平台的设计与实现 随着教育信息化的不断发展,高校机房已经成为学校重要的信息技术支撑平台之一。高校机房管理对于维护机房正常运行、保障信息安全以及学生学习和科研工作的顺利进行具有至关重要的作用。因此,如何有效地实现高校机房管理是很多高校面临的问题。在此背景下,本文提出了基于BS模式的高校机房管理支撑平台设计与实现。 一、BS模式基本原理 BS模式即Browser/Server模式(浏览器/服务器模式),它是一种应用程序架构,是Web应用程序的基本结构。该模式的原理是将应用程序划分为客户端和服务端两个部分。客户端是通过浏览器进行访问的,它负责展示用户界面。服务端负责处理业务逻辑和数据库操作。 BS模式有以下几个优点: 1.可跨平台:由于浏览器是跨平台的,因此使用BS模式的Web应用程序可以在各种设备上运行,包括PC、平板、手机等。 2.易于维护:Web应用程序的代码和数据维护在服务端,这样就避免了在客户端进行软件更新的麻烦。 3.安全性高:客户端只要负责展示用户界面,不涉及任何业务逻辑和数据库操作,因此不容易受到黑客攻击。 二、基于BS模式高校机房管理支撑平台的设计与实现 基于BS模式的高校机房管理支撑平台主要包括前端和后端两个部分。前端采用HTML、CSS、JavaScript等技术实现,后端采用Java语言,使用SpringMVC框架进行开发。 1.前端设计与实现 前端采用响应式设计,以适应不同终端设备的显示效果。前端主要包括以下几个模块: 1.1登录模块 该模块提供用户登录功能,用户登录成功后才能进入系统。登录采用用户名和密码验证方式,登录信息保存在服务端的数据库中。 1.2设备管理模块 该模块用于管理机房中的设备信息,包括设备的名称、型号、IP地址、MAC地址、所属机房等,支持设备的添加、删除、修改和查询等操作。设备信息保存在服务端的数据库中。 1.3机房管理模块 该模块用于管理机房信息,包括机房的名称、位置、所属学院、联系人等,支持机房的添加、删除、修改和查询等操作。机房信息保存在服务端的数据库中。 1.4日志管理模块 该模块用于管理操作日志,记录所有用户的操作信息,包括用户、操作时间、操作类型、IP地址等。日志信息保存在服务端的数据库中。 2.后端设计与实现 后端采用Java语言进行开发,使用SpringMVC框架实现。后端主要包括以下几个模块: 2.1控制器 该模块负责接收前端发送的请求,并根据请求类型进行相应的处理。控制器将请求转发给相应的服务层处理,并将结果返回给前端。控制器的代码保存在服务端。 2.2服务层 该模块负责处理业务逻辑,包括设备管理、机房管理、日志管理等。 2.3数据库 该模块负责存储实际数据,包括设备信息、机房信息、日志信息等。 三、总结 本文介绍了基于BS模式的高校机房管理支撑平台的设计与实现。该平台可实现对设备、机房等信息的管理,能够提高管理效率并确保机房信息的安全和稳定。该平台采用BS模式,可以在各种设备上进行访问,具有跨平台性和易维护性等优点。

快乐****蜜蜂
实名认证
内容提供者


最近下载